Final answer:

A substance made from a chemical change is known as a product and can be found on the right side of the arrow in a chemical equation.

Step-by-step explanation:

A substance made from a chemical change is a product. It is located on the right side of the equation in a chemical reaction. For example, considering the chemical equation for the combustion of methane:

CH4 + 2O2 → CO2 + 2H2O

In this equation, methane (CH4) and oxygen (O2) are the reactants listed on the left side of the arrow, while carbon dioxide (CO2) and water (H2O) are the products shown on the right side. The arrow (→) signifies the direction of the chemical reaction, from reactants to products, indicating that a chemical change has occurred.
